## Step 4 — Configure flag service

Plugin authors: Switchyard reads flag definitions at boot. Set `FLAG_SOURCE=remote` and `FLAG_POLL_SEC=15`. Local overrides go in `flags.local.toml`; never ship them. Rollout percentages are server-side only — plugins must not hardcode cohorts. Your plugin authenticates to the Switchyard control plane via an env credential; put it on the next line of your environment file:

sealed setting: VAULT_KEY20=c8ea1e419912889df6b4

- [ ] **Step 7: Breaker override escrow.** After sealing the signing keys for the Tallgrove upstream API circuit breaker, confirm the support team can force the breaker open during a full outage. The override bundle lives in the sealed escrow drawer and is useless without its unlock phrase. Two ceremony witnesses must initial this step before proceeding. The escrow bundle is decrypted with the recovery passphrase that follows.

vault phrase of kahip-kahop = holath-quenmir

TURN-208: Gatevale turnstile counters at the Merrow Field pilot double-count when a rotation reverses mid-cycle. Attendance totals drift roughly 2% high per event. The debounce window fix is implemented, reviewed by Ilsa, and soak-tested across two simulated match days without drift. Ready for your cut; the candidate build is identified below.

trace token, tagag-tafog: htk6_5ed18c

TICKET-2841: Extract user module from Korvane monolith

The profile endpoints still call the legacy session table directly, blocking the split. Repro: 1) Start Korvane locally with the user-service flag enabled. 2) Log in as any seeded account. 3) Hit /api/v2/profile. 4) Observe a 500 because the extracted service can't read legacy sessions. Fix routes profile reads through the new UserGateway. To verify against the staging gateway, authenticate with the token below.

session JWT of yawep-yawep = eyJhbGciOiJIUzI1NiIsInR5cCI6IkpXVCJ9.eyJzdWIiOiI3pWF3_In0.aXYsHiog

FACILITIES TICKET — Night Shift

Floor 6 at Harrowmere House opens Monday for the Vexler Dynamics expansion. Lifts already serve the floor; stairwell doors unlock at 05:00. Night crew: check HVAC panels and emergency lighting before 04:00. Report faults to the duty lead, not day shift. Temporary access runs through the east turnstile only. Use the following pass code at the floor 6 door.

turnstile pass: bdg-NG-3